IMD weather update: Heavy rainfall predicted in Odisha, Himachal, other states | Check forecast

New Delhi: The India Meteorological Department (IMD) has predicted heavy rainfall in several parts of the country including Odisha, Himachal Pradesh and Gujarat for today. The weather officer has also forecast very heavy to extremely heavy rainfall in Andhra Pradesh, Chhattisgarh, and Telangana on August 30 and 31.

“Deep Depression over Saurashtra and Kutch likely to continue to move slowly westsouthwestwards and reach Saurashtra and Kutch coast adjoining northeast Arabian Sea by 29th August. Extremely heavy rainfall very likely to continue at isolated places of Saurashtra and Kutch on 29th August,” the IMD said in its weather bulletin.

Heavy rainfall warning for Himachal, Odisha

Meanwhile, the local Met office has issued a yellow alert forecasting heavy rains accompanied with thunderstorms and lightning at isolated places in 10 out of 12 districts of Himachal Pradesh barring Kinnaur and Lahaul and Spiti on Thursday.

According to Met Department, many parts of Odisha will also receive heavy to very heavy rainfall till August 31. IMD said a fresh low-pressure area is expected to form over east central and adjoining north Bay of Bengal on August 29. It is likely to move towards south Odisha and north Andhra Pradesh coasts. In view of the formation of the weather system, Odisha may witness an active wet spell till August 31, it said. The IMD has issued an ‘orange’ warning (be prepared) for Malkangiri, Koraput, Nabarangpur and Rayagada districts for Thursday, and Malkangiri and Koraput for Friday. Fishermen have been advised not to venture into the sea along and off Odisha coasts on August 30 and 31.
